General
Power source ...................14.4 V DC (12.0 V to 14.4 V al-
lowable)
Grounding system ............Negative type
Maximum current consumption
...................................10.0 A
Backup current ................... 5 mA or less
Dimensions (W × H × D):
D
Chassis .............. 178 mm × 100 mm ×
165 mm
Nose .................. 171 mm × 97 mm ×
21 mm
B
Weight ............................. 2.1 kg
Display
Screen size/aspect ratio ... 176.5 mm wide/16:9
(effective display area:
156.6 mm × 81.6 mm)
Pixels ............................... 1 152 000 (2 400 × 480)
Display method ................ TFT active matrix, driving type
Color system .................... NTSC/PAL/PAL-M/PAL-N/
SECAM compatible
Durable temperature range (power off)
...................................–20 °C to +80 °C

Audio
Maximum power output ... 50 W × 4
70 W × 1/2 Ω (for subwoofer)
Continuous power output
................................... 22 W × 4 (50 Hz to 15 000 Hz,
5 % THD, 4 Ω load, both chan-
nels driven)
Load impedance .............. 4 Ω (4 Ω to 8 Ω (2 Ω for 1 ch)
allowable)
Preout maximum output level
................................... 4.0 V
Equalizer (8-Band Graphic Equalizer):
Frequency ................. 40 Hz/80 Hz/200 Hz/400 Hz/
1 kHz/2.5 kHz/8 kHz/10 kHz
D
Gain ......................... ±12 dB
HPF:
Frequency ................. 50 Hz/63 Hz/80 Hz/100 Hz/
125 Hz
Slope ........................ –12 dB/oct
Subwoofer (mono):
Frequency ................. 50 Hz/63 Hz/80 Hz/100 Hz/
125 Hz
Slope ........................ –18 dB/oct
Gain ......................... +6 dB to –24 dB
Phase ....................... Normal/Reverse
Bass boost:
Gain ......................... +12 dB to 0 dB
